        "ResourceName": "A Three-Dimensional Plasma and Energetic particle investigation for the Wind spacecraft",
        "_ResourceName": "Source: Master/CDFglobalAttributes/Logical_source_description",
        "AlternateName": "wind_3dp_l3-eesalow-moments",
        "_AlternateName": "Source: Master/CDFglobalAttributes/Logical_source",
        "Description": "BAD  for Q_FLAG = (V_oe,x GE -50 km/s) OR  (|qe//|/qeo GE 1) OR  (T_e,j LE 1 eV)GOOD for Q_FLAG = (V_oe,x LT -50 km/s) AND (|qe//|/qeo LT 1) AND (T_e,j GT 1 eV)The definition of GOOD and BAD derive from physically meaningful constraints as follows:Values of V_oe,x above -50 km/s start to imply possible sunward electron flow in the spacecraft frame, which is not physicalValues of |qe//|/qeo at or above unity makes no physical sense since qeo is the free-streaming maximum limitValues of T_e,j at or below 1 eV are not meaningful as the instrument cannot measure such cold distributions",
